Capabilities
A group member’s capabilities are a u32 bitmask, carried as a Long in
Kotlin (so the full unsigned range stays a positive value). Capabilities exposes
the bit constants core assigns, plus helpers for reading and editing a mask. Use
them with the group capability methods on
mero.admin
(getMemberCapabilities, setMemberCapabilities, getDefaultCapabilities,
setDefaultCapabilities). The
groups & governance guide shows a
full flow.
Constants
Section titled “Constants”Core MemberCapabilities, bits 0–8 (all const val … : Long):
object Capabilities { const val CAN_CREATE_CONTEXT = 1L // 1 shl 0 const val CAN_INVITE_MEMBERS = 2L // 1 shl 1 const val CAN_JOIN_OPEN_SUBGROUPS = 4L // 1 shl 2 const val MANAGE_MEMBERS = 8L // 1 shl 3 const val MANAGE_APPLICATION = 16L // 1 shl 4 const val CAN_CREATE_SUBGROUP = 32L // 1 shl 5 const val CAN_DELETE_SUBGROUP = 64L // 1 shl 6 const val CAN_MANAGE_VISIBILITY = 128L // 1 shl 7 const val CAN_MANAGE_METADATA = 256L // 1 shl 8}Helpers
Section titled “Helpers”All normalize to the unsigned 32-bit range.
fun hasCap(mask: Long, cap: Long): Boolean // every bit of cap set?fun withCap(mask: Long, cap: Long): Long // mask with cap setfun withoutCap(mask: Long, cap: Long): Long // mask with cap clearedExample
Section titled “Example”import com.calimero.mero.Capabilities
// MemberCapabilities.capabilities is an Int; the helpers work on Long.val current = mero.admin.getMemberCapabilities(groupId, identity = id).capabilitiesvar mask = current.toLong()
if (!Capabilities.hasCap(mask, Capabilities.CAN_INVITE_MEMBERS)) { mask = Capabilities.withCap(mask, Capabilities.CAN_INVITE_MEMBERS) mask = Capabilities.withCap(mask, Capabilities.CAN_CREATE_SUBGROUP) mask = Capabilities.withoutCap(mask, Capabilities.CAN_MANAGE_METADATA) mero.admin.setMemberCapabilities( groupId, identity = id, SetMemberCapabilitiesRequest(capabilities = mask.toInt()) )}
